Boater classes offered by Northern Neck Sail & Power Squadronnext month

The Northern Neck Sail & Power Squadron will hold a number of boater education classes and free seminars in March.Beginning Monday, March 2 from 6-8 p.m. and continuing for another seven weeks, the group will offer a class in sailing at a cost of $95 for non-members; $20 discount for members. Learn the basics of sailing, boat designs, terminology, rigging and safety from experienced U.S. Power Squadron sailors. The course covers types of sailboat rigs, hull shapes, sail configurations and standing rigging. Wind and water forces affect sailboat stability and balance, sail shape and tuning the standing rig. Steering and helmsmanship, sailing upwind, downwind and spinnaker handling. A class to help people get their VA Boater Certification Card will be held from 10 a.m.-3 p.m. on March 14 and 21.
